How Artificial Intelligence Transforms Imaging

Across the digital world, machine learning models examine thousands of visual samples and learn patterns, allowing devices to predict ideal adjustments. This is why smartphones can detect low light, adjust shadows, or stabilize a fast-moving subject. Applications in Security, Creativity, and Automation

Artificial intelligence now assists security systems by identifying potential threats, distinguishing people from animals, or alerting homeowners to unusual activity. In creative fields, artists rely on AI-based correction tools to modify style, color tones, or mood.
